The Spring issue of Taonga magazine

Taonga magazine goes to the heart of this Church for a feast of reading about people and places.

JULANNE CLARKE-MORRIS  |  17 Sep 2015  |

• This Spring 2015 issue of Taonga magazine goes on the rounds with Nelson’s faith-filled parish nurses  – and finds they’re walking in Jesus’ shoes.

• We look toward the Common Life Ministry Conference with an interview with main speaker, global evangelism expert Chris Wright.

• Four Kiwi Anglicans face a challenge from Asian Christians in Jakarta, while Carole Hughes brings a gender balance target home from the UN in New York.

• We meet our new Strandz Children’s Ministry enabler– Diana Langdon – and catch up with her big vision for small disciples.

• Lloyd Ashton introduces us to Australia’s newest Aboriginal bishop, Chris McLeod, who lets us  in on the story that has made him.

• Young theologians from across the Tikanga dive into scripture and tradition for clues on godly living, while Rod Oram looks for hopeful signs that churches are tackling climate change.

• Two stories zero in on how and what we eat: Sarah Wilcox goes vegan, and Phillip Donnell heads out into the garden.  

• Parenting guru John Cowan takes on the dilemma of clergy kids, and Adrienne Thompson shares gems from spiritual direction.

• John Stenhouse shows how 20th century Kiwi history shunted the church into the sidings, and historian George Davis reflects on Anzac memorial in 2015.

• Before we head into the books and film, Taonga online editor Brian Thomas shares vignettes of local and worldwide news from the web.
